When Alphonso David became president of the nation’s largest L.G.B.T.Q.+ advocacy organization in 2019, his long experience as Gov.

Andrew M. Cuomo’s chief legal counsel and secretary on civil rights was seen as a huge advantage. In his nine years working for the governor, Mr.

David had helped to propel many of Mr. Cuomo’s triumphs in L.G.B.T.Q. rights, from marriage equality to a ban on conversion therapy, which was a large part of why the leadership of the organization, the Human Rights Campaign, said they had hired him.
